What is the Cherry MX Board 1.0?

The Cherry MX Board 1.0 is a mechanical keyboard. Mechanical keyboards use individual switches for each key. This makes them different from regular keyboards. Cherry MX is a brand known for high-quality switches. They provide a great typing experience.

Tech Specs for Cherry MX Board 1.0

  • Dimensions: 470 x 165 x 25 mm
  • Weight: 1165 g
  • Connection: USB
  • Illumination: Yes (one color)
  • Cable Length: 180 cm
  • Key Rollover: NKRO
  • Numpad: Yes
  • Macro Keys: No macro keys
  • Media Keys: Yes (integrated)
  • USB Passthrough: No USB Passthrough
  • Switches: Cherry MX Brown, Cherry MX Silent Red
  • Keycaps: Laser etched ABS keycaps
  • Extras: With palm rest
  • Available since: Nov. 2018

Types of Cherry MX Switches

Cherry MX switches come in different types. Each type has a unique feel and sound. Here are the main types:

Switch TypeFeelSound Level
Cherry MX RedSmooth and linearQuiet
Cherry MX BrownTactile and softModerate
Cherry MX BlueTactile and clickyLoud
